Cost of Construction Site Grading in Fort Walton Beach
Constructing a new building or renovating an existing one in Fort Walton Beach, FL, involves several crucial steps, one of the most important being site grading. Site grading is essential to ensure a level foundation and proper drainage, which can significantly impact the overall success and longevity of a construction project. Understanding the cost of construction site grading in Fort Walton Beach, FL, can help property owners and contractors budget effectively and plan their projects more efficiently.
Factors Affecting Cost
- Site Size: Larger sites require more extensive grading work, increasing labor and equipment costs.
- Soil Type: Sandy soils common in Fort Walton Beach may be easier to grade, whereas rocky or clay-heavy soils can increase costs.
- Slope and Elevation: Sites with significant elevation changes or steep slopes need more complex grading, which can be more expensive.
- Accessibility: Sites that are difficult to access may require specialized equipment or additional labor, raising the cost.
- Permits and Inspections: Local regulations may necessitate permits and inspections, adding to the overall expense.
- Existing Vegetation: Removing trees, shrubs, and other vegetation can increase the time and cost of grading.
